What is the Mind-Body Connection?


The mind-body connection refers to the relationship between our thoughts, emotions, and physical sensations. It's a recognition that our mental and emotional states have a direct impact on our physical health and vice versa. For example, stress and anxiety can manifest in physical symptoms such as headaches, muscle tension, and digestive issues, while physical pain and discomfort can impact our mental and emotional well-being.

The Benefits of Mindful Practices


Mindful practices, such as meditation, yoga, and deep breathing, can help us to connect with our bodies and our minds, reduce stress, and improve our physical and mental health. These practices can also help us to cultivate a greater sense of self-awareness, compassion, and resilience.

Here are a few benefits of incorporating mindful practices into your daily routine:

  1. Reduces stress and anxiety: Mindful practices can help to lower levels of the stress hormone cortisol, reducing feelings of stress and anxiety.

  2. Improves physical health: Mindful practices have been shown to improve symptoms of chronic pain, lower blood pressure, and boost the immune system.

  3. Enhances mental clarity and focus: By calming the mind and reducing distractions, mindful practices can improve mental clarity and focus.

  4. Promotes self-awareness and emotional regulation: Mindful practices can help us to become more self-aware, allowing us to recognize and regulate our emotions more effectively.

  5. Increases feelings of happiness and well-being: Regular mindfulness practice has been shown to increase feelings of happiness, joy, and well-being.

Getting Started with Mindful Practices


Getting started with mindful practices can be as simple as setting aside a few minutes each day for quiet reflection or meditation. You can also try incorporating yoga or deep breathing into your routine or simply paying more attention to your physical sensations and emotions throughout the day.
